Indications You Required Repiping



Typically, homeowners may ignore subtle indications that their pipes system needs repiping - Repipe Specialists. One of one of the most common indications is regular leaks or water discolorations on ceilings and wall surfaces, recommending aging pipelines that may no much longer be trusted. Furthermore, if water stress comes to be inconsistent, it can suggest deterioration or blockages within the pipes system. Home owners must additionally look out to discoloration in tap water, which might signify rust or contaminants from weakening pipelines. Unpleasant smells rising from the plumbing can better suggest underlying issues. One more vital variable is the age of the pipes system; homes developed over half a century earlier often make use of obsolete products prone to failing. If multiple components experience troubles concurrently, it is a solid sign that repiping might be necessary. Recognizing these indications can aid homeowners address plumbing problems before they escalate right into more considerable problems

Copper vs. PEX Contrast



Choosing the best materials for repiping is important, as it can greatly influence the longevity and performance of a pipes system. When contrasting copper and PEX, both products offer distinct advantages. Copper pipelines are known for their resilience, resistance to corrosion, and ability to stand up to heats. They likewise have a long lifespan, usually exceeding 50 years. Copper can be more expensive and requires soldering for installation, which may increase labor prices.


On the various other hand, PEX (cross-linked polyethylene) is light-weight, adaptable, and less complicated to install, often leading to reduced labor expenses. PEX is resistant to scale and chlorine, and it does not rust. Ultimately, the choice between copper and PEX depends on particular pipes needs and choices for resilience and setup approaches.

Longevity and Sturdiness Variables



Selecting the best products for repiping is essential, as the longevity and sturdiness of the pipes system directly influence the overall effectiveness and maintenance costs. Usual products consist of copper, PEX, and CPVC, each offering distinctive advantages. Copper is renowned for its durability and resistance to deterioration, while PEX is flexible, resistant to freezing, and much less prone to leakages, making it perfect for her latest blog various setups. CPVC, on the other hand, is cost-efficient and resistant to chemicals however may not endure heats in addition to copper. Inevitably, the choice of product ought to take into consideration factors such as water high quality, local environment, and certain plumbing needs. An educated decision can significantly boost the life expectancy of the pipes system, leading to fewer fixings and lower long-lasting expenditures.


The Repiping Refine Explained



When a home owner determines to repipe their residential property, understanding the process can aid alleviate concerns and ensure a smoother experience. The repiping process normally begins with a detailed assessment, enabling professionals to examine the existing plumbing system's problem and determine areas needing attention. Following this analysis, the group goes over the ideal strategies and materials matched for the home.

Once the house owner accepts the plan, specialists prepare the site by protecting furnishings and floor covering. The real repiping job includes removing old pipelines and installing brand-new ones, which may consist of copper, PEX, or PVC materials. Throughout this phase, plumbing professionals determine the system's design maximizes efficiency and reduces prospective concerns. After installment, rigorous testing is performed to confirm that whatever features correctly, schuler plumbing followed by bring back the site to its initial condition. This thorough technique ensures a reputable pipes system that satisfies contemporary criteria and considerably lowers future repair work demands.

Keeping Your New Pipes System



To ensure the durability and effectiveness of a recently set up pipes system, regular upkeep is essential. Home owners ought to schedule regular assessments to determine possible problems prior to they rise. This consists of checking for leakages, rust, and obstructions, which can compromise the system's stability.


In addition, flushing the system regularly helps eliminate sediment build-up, promoting optimal water flow. It is likewise suggested to keep track of water pressure, as extreme stress can stress fittings and pipelines, leading to early failure.


Making use of top quality fixtures and elements can enhance resilience, but they require interest. Home owners must be watchful concerning indicators of wear, such as unusual sounds or water staining.


Engaging professional pipes services for maintenance jobs assures that any needed repair services are performed with competence, inevitably safeguarding the investment in a new pipes system and promoting its effectiveness over the years.

How much time Does a Normal Repiping Job Require To Total?



A typical repiping job normally takes in between one to 5 days to complete, relying on the size of the building, complexity of the plumbing system, and the certain products used during the repiping process.


Will Repiping Influence My Water Pressure?



Repiping can boost water stress by replacing old, rusty pipelines that limit flow. Houston Repipe. In some situations, if not effectively sized or set up, it may momentarily decrease water pressure up until changes are made.



Can I Remain In My Home During Repiping?



Usually, homeowners can stay in their homes throughout repiping, though disruptions might happen. It is advisable to plan for temporary water failures and limitation accessibility to particular areas to guarantee safety and security and effectiveness throughout the process.


Exist Service Warranties for Repiping Services?



Yes, many repiping services offer warranties that cover craftsmanship and products. The specifics, including duration and coverage information, can differ by business, so it is a good idea to ask directly for comprehensive details before continuing.


Just how Frequently Should I Consider Repiping My Home?



House owners must think about repiping every 20 to half a century, relying on pipe material, water, and condition quality. Normal assessments can help identify problems, prompting repiping sooner if leakages, corrosion, or various other significant troubles occur.
